Chapter 3 mentions something I cannot seem to find anywhere else.

"The order in which the PCs explore the Harrowed
Realm is up to them, but three events will take
place as they travel. The first of these, Event 5, takes
place automatically the first time they arrive in the
Harrowed Realm."

Were these three events removed? They don't appear at all.


1 person marked this as a favorite.

It 2nd this. There seem to be references to events that are just missing altogether.

Paizo Employee Creative Director

The events turned into encounters, keyed to specific locations in that chapter. Originally many of those encounters were "free roaming" ones that could take place anywhere, but I chose to link them to specific sites to encourage and reward the party for exploring key locations and also to support those encounters with interesting maps.

But then forgot to strip out the mention of those encounters' original incarnation as events.

So you can just ignore the bit about there being events at all. All that content is still in the chapter, just now it's located in the form of encounters at interesting locations.

Sorry about the confusion.

Something I'm highly confused by: why is Voricose now a velstract?

I mean, I get that some of storykin have been converted to velstrac, but text refers to Voricose as one member of the original invasion force when he was Cyclops storykin in Harrowing module. Is this just an error?

Like everything makes sense if I just assume original invasion force is editing error and he is just another converted storykin

That's an error. He should be another converted storykin.
